Output 98612b3259cece6ab49a0c61261ec1a4d70360b7fd50259f18d74ddf5fbd88ad:87

value
287836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23d81e3c613628bf50b46c72d2bc6636af84352c OP_EQUAL
address
34xYUQaJxjxX35vqRTTaz28DyG9QZ4aQ2M
transaction
98612b3259cece6ab49a0c61261ec1a4d70360b7fd50259f18d74ddf5fbd88ad